In the role of Technical Animator, you'll work with the animation and engineering teams to devise solutions and workflows, creating rigs for animators and high-fidelity deformation for assets.

Your analytical ability and planning skills will help the studio develop tools for the future to support character and animation production.

You'll also be responsible for our motion pipeline from creating custom rigs, optimising workflows with scripts to keyframe animation.


As a Technical Animator, you will be supporting the needs of the animators by ensuring they have the tools they need to do their jobs.

As well as pushing the animation fidelity, you will be controlling the animation pipelines on our games to help us achieve stunning results, whilst keeping efficiency at its peak.

The Technical Animator works with both in-house animators and external partners, as well as our engineers.

Skills and experience:


  • To act as a bridge between both the Technical and Creative disciplines.
  • Expert knowledge of 3D animation packages such as Maya, with a technical focus on rigging, skinning and tools scripting.
  • Strong knowledge and experience of rigging methods and deformation in Maya and Unreal, related to video game rigs.
  • Ability to code with Python or PyMel. Creating tools and scripts to increase productivity of the art team or other asset creators.
  • Experience helping to maintain animations in Unreal Engine 4 or Unreal Engine 5 (or other game engines).
  • Good understanding of Unreal's runtime animation systems such as statemachines and animation blueprints.
  • Motivated, creative and able to utilise own initiative to implement solutions and improvements to internal processes.
  • Solid understanding of Character deformation techniques and dynamics. Be it cloth, bones, blend shapes or displacement maps.
  • A strong portfolio demonstrating your animation rigs and rigging tool development for games.
  • Solid understanding of facial animation methodologies.
  • Foreseeing potential issues and communicating effectively to department leads.
  • Critiquing assets on an ongoing basis to drive continual improvement and ensure quality across the game within defined budgets.

It'd also be great if you have:

  • Knowledge of the Maya API and lower level programming languages such as C++
  • Production experience developing a AAA quality game.
  • Some experience or understand of Facial Capture technology and Facial Analysis software.
